My only prior cruising experience is on Princess...so bear in mind that context.

 

When I log on to Carnival, I'd like to use my OBC towards tips or pre-purchasing items. I did this on the Princess site last year. I'm not finding any place to even see my OBC listed? I tried to buy a pack of bottled water, but it was going to my credit card instead of using the OBC.

 

Am I missing something or is this simply not a part of the functionality of the Carnival site?

 

Also...when is the formal night? I'm having difficulty finding when that is (or how many there are) on my cruise. (5 night Sat-Thur)

 

Thanks for educating a newb.

With CCL, can only use OBC once on-board. If you do not pre-pay gratuities they will be applied to your on-board account on the second day and can be offset with any OBC you may have.

OBC may only be used on board. To pre-pay for anything, a credit card or gift card is required. You may see how much OBC you have by viewing your cruise documents under manage my cruise. It will be on your invoice.

 

Formal night(s) are usually on the first full sea day and the next to last full sea day. I am not sure if the 5 day will have more than one.

The above posters are correct, OBC is only to be used on board. If you wish to use it to purchase water, you can call room service after boarding (there won't be any until very late in the day the first day) and order it for the same price as posted online prior to sailing.

 

Your elegant night (you'll only have one) will be on the first full sea day.
